The 1999 season in Swedish football, starting January 1999 and ending December 1999:
Honours
Official titles
| Title | Team | Reason |
|---|---|---|
| Swedish Champions 1999 | Helsingborgs IF | Winners of Allsvenskan |
| Swedish Cup Champions 1998–99 | AIK | Winners of Svenska Cupen |
Competitions
| Level | Competition | Team |
|---|---|---|
| 1st level | Allsvenskan 1999 | Helsingborgs IF |
| 2nd level | Division 1 Norra 1999 | GIF Sundsvall |
| Division 1 Södra 1999 | BK Häcken | |
| Cup | Svenska Cupen 1998–99 | AIK |

Domestic results
Allsvenskan 1999
| Team | Pld | W | D | L | GF | GA | GD | Pts |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Helsingborgs IF | 26 | 17 | 3 | 6 | 44 | – | 24 | +20 | 54 |
| 2 | AIK | 26 | 16 | 5 | 5 | 42 | – | 14 | +28 | 53 |
| 3 | Halmstads BK | 26 | 14 | 6 | 6 | 43 | – | 22 | +21 | 48 |
| 4 | Örgryte IS | 26 | 11 | 10 | 5 | 41 | – | 23 | +18 | 43 |
| 5 | IFK Norrköping | 26 | 11 | 6 | 9 | 41 | – | 36 | +5 | 39 |
| 6 | IFK Göteborg | 26 | 11 | 5 | 10 | 27 | – | 33 | -6 | 38 |
| 7 | Västra Frölunda IF | 26 | 9 | 7 | 10 | 30 | – | 33 | -3 | 34 |
| 8 | Trelleborgs FF | 26 | 9 | 6 | 11 | 39 | – | 47 | -8 | 33 |
| 9 | IF Elfsborg | 26 | 9 | 5 | 12 | 41 | – | 48 | -7 | 32 |
| 10 | Hammarby IF | 26 | 8 | 5 | 13 | 32 | – | 42 | -10 | 29 |
| 11 | Kalmar FF | 26 | 8 | 4 | 14 | 27 | – | 41 | -14 | 28 |
| 12 | Örebro SK | 26 | 8 | 3 | 15 | 24 | – | 36 | -12 | 27 |
| 13 | Malmö FF | 26 | 7 | 4 | 15 | 30 | – | 48 | -18 | 25 |
| 14 | Djurgårdens IF | 26 | 5 | 9 | 12 | 27 | – | 41 | -14 | 24 |
